!6 ouncer with "canned on 1/14/21" stamped on the bottom.
Pours out with a lighter hue, hazed/lightly juiced with a nice looking frothy off white cap and leaving fine tiny bubble lacing on the glass.
Light sniff of fresh tropical fruits.
On the palate its a tropical melange with grapefruit leading the way, along with pineapple, and some lime bitterness. Nicely done, quite tasty and well worth a try,

-richly yellow and cloudy, this tap pour hosts a 1 cm foam cap and an aroma of citrus and pine. The flavor is full, with orange, orange zest, a bit of resin and a tangy, spicy note. The brew is light-bodied and quite tasty. -well done

White-straw color. Very (milkshake) cloudy. Chunky streaks of lace.
Mild aroma but with good balance of pale malt and white pepper hop smells.
The flavor is sweeter than expected but the hop presence dominates. Higher than typical body and effervescence. The finish is surprising thin in flavor but the aftertaste does have a lingering bitterness.
